Information Centric Security; the Way to Go?

Combined Session
Thursday, May 07, 2015 12:00—13:00
Location: ALPSEE

In the current world of fast-moving organizations with high demands of new services and supporting IT-systems we can no longer deal with the "old" perimeterized way of protecting the organizations assets. We are in need of a much more focussed and efficient approach that will allow us to protect our assets on their needs. Classification of information and protecting at it it's source is the way forward. Solutions have evolved that can make this happen without the major downsides of previous technologies that had business users adjust their behaviour and think about the needed protection at the end-user level. Nowadays technologies can be implemented that are transparent and easy-to-use while protecting the organizations assets against abuse and misplacement. The presentation will describe the changing landscape, the methodology to such an approach and a description of technologies that can assist in moving forward protecting your information.
